Types Explained

Clumping Clay Litter

Made from sodium bentonite clay that forms hard clumps when wet, making scooping easy. Excellent odor control, but can be dusty.

Best for: Pet owners who prioritize easy cleaning and strong odor control.

Antibacterial Litter

Litters with added antimicrobial agents that actively destroy odor-causing bacteria, offering an extra layer of hygiene.

Best for: Multi-cat households or homes where litter box hygiene is a top concern.

Multi-Cat Litter

Formulated to handle heavy use with stronger clumps and more odor absorbers, often enhanced with baking soda or other additives.

Best for: Homes with two or more cats, or very large cats that produce more waste.

Lightweight Litter

Lower density clay or alternative materials that are easier to carry and pour, but may track more or have softer clumps.

Best for: Pet owners who struggle with heavy litter bags, especially the elderly or those with mobility issues.

Living With It

Care, Cost and Maintenance

Daily Scooping

Scoop clumps and solid waste at least once a day to keep the litter box fresh and reduce odor buildup. Use a slotted scoop to minimize litter removal.

Monthly Litter Change

Completely empty the litter box every 3-4 weeks, wash it with mild soap and water, dry thoroughly, and refill with fresh litter to prevent bacterial growth.

Proper Litter Depth

Maintain 2-3 inches of litter to allow thorough clumping and absorption. Too little may cause urine to pool, too much may cause excessive tracking.

Frequently asked questions

How often should I completely change the litter?
We recommend a full litter change every 3-4 weeks, depending on the number of cats. For multiple cats, you may need to change it every 2-3 weeks.
Is scented litter safe for my cat?
Generally, yes, but some cats may be sensitive to strong perfumes. Unscented options are safer for sensitive cats. We noticed that heavily scented litters masked odor initially but could irritate respiratory systems.
What is the best litter for odor control?
Based on our testing, clumping clay litters with baking soda or activated charcoal, like ARM & HAMMER Clump & Seal SLIDE, provide excellent odor control. Antibacterial litters also help reduce bacterial odor.
Can I flush clumping litter down the toilet?
No, we do not recommend flushing any cat litter. Even flushable labels can clog pipes and harm septic systems. Always dispose of waste in the trash.
How do I reduce litter tracking?
Use a high-sided litter box or a top-entry box, and place a large mat outside the box. We also found that heavier clay litters track less than lightweight or crystal types.
